Procurement & Supplier Management Apprentice

2 months ago


Bristol, South West England, United Kingdom myGwork Full time

This inclusive employer is a member of myGwork – the largest global platform for the LGBTQ+ business community.

ROLE OVERVIEW

This is a great opportunity for the right person to get globally recognised training from the Chartered Institute for Procurement and Supply (CIPS) and on the job experience of the professional delivery of procurement and supplier management activities - activities which are key to businesses in all sectors in all parts of the world.

This role, which sits within the Supplier Management Office (SMO), provides procurement and supplier management services to key stakeholders within the firm. The role (after training and introduction) will be responsible for supporting all aspects of procurement and supplier management which includes processing the purchasing of IT and Facilities services, software and hardware for the firm through an agreed set of supplier relationships, supporting contract tender processes, supporting supplier and contract management processes, administrating the checking of supplier invoices before payment and keeping supplier and contract data current in our database. This is a hands-on role that - once up to speed - requires the post holder to support all day to day procurement and supplier management services delivered by the SMO.

Duties and Responsibilities include but not are limited to the following:

  • Responsible for supporting the administration of the procurement lifecycle within RPC including but not limited to obtaining competitive quotes from our supplier list, purchasing including managing requests from stakeholders for good and services, obtaining approvals to commit spend and raising purchase orders, managing/processing invoices to ensure timely payment of our suppliers, tracking supplier delivery times/logistics and supply issues.
  • Processing of invoices & reconciliation to budget and linking with the Finance team as necessary
  • Responsible for supporting the monitoring of spend against budget on an on-going basis. This includes the updating of individual budget lines communicating budget status to stakeholders as necessary.
  • Responsible for supporting all supplier information management including updating and maintaining the critical data sources that drive the SMO's core processes. This includes updating and maintaining the supplier contracts database and other repositories where information is securely stored on the firm's systems.
  • Once trained , preparing regular and adhoc Management Information reports on the SMO's business as usual and project related activities.
  • Once trained , Working with the firm's internal stakeholders and suppliers to obtain quotations , purchase, track and renew services as required.
  • Once trained , responsible for understanding and ensuring adherence to the firm's procurement and supplier management rules .
  • Supporting the management of the contract renewal anniversaries including working with supplier relationship owners to understand their needs.
  • Support Delivery of tasks and/or workstreams for projects that are led by the SMO or where the SMO is a stakeholder.
  • Contributing to the continuous improvement of the SMO knowledge base with relevant knowledge to reflect changes and additions to operating processes.
